Study on Fabrication of BMC Laminates Based on Unsaturated Polyester Resin Reinforced by Hybrid Bamboo/Glass Fibers

TL;DR: In this paper, a composite material reinforced with 25 wt% hybrid fibers (25% bamboo and 75% glass fibers) showed better physico-mechanical properties (tensile strength: 37.0 MPA, flexural strength: 140 MPa, impact strength: 32 kJ/m2) than other combinations.
